Hiawassee, Georgia
Big Nate is a 4 bedroom cabin with 2 full kitchens and 2 living rooms and 2400 sq ft of space. He is the bear who will greet you at the door. There are also 5 bathrooms in Big Nate for your convenience and privacy. The terrain is an easy slope for walking and a great place for kids to play. We have a seesaw and horse swing for the younger kids and horse shoes for the older kids. Big Nate has its own separate boat dock and a ramp to put your boat in the water. We have a 15 ft trampoline with a slide and launch. You can fish off the boat docks or just lay around and swim. There is a fireplace with shed and a firepit to sit around at night. There is lots of space to have your family outings.
